Samba weather in July

In July, Samba sees average daytime highs of 27°C and overnight lows near 19°C, with 0 mm of rain across 0 wet days and about 11.5 hours of daylight. It is the 12th-warmest and 12th-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 27°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 58% of the time in July, and the air most often feels humid.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 30 min at the start of July to 11 h 36 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, July is Samba's 2nd-clearest and 11th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Samba's year-round climate.

Temperature in July

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 27°C through the month.

A typical July day in Samba reaches about 27°C in the afternoon and slips back to 19°C overnight — a 9°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 26°C and 29°C. Set against its neighbours, July runs about 2°C cooler than June and on par with August.

Air quality in Samba in July

GoodModeratePoorUnhealthyVery unhealthy

Average fine-particle pollution (PM2.5) through the year — so you can see where July falls, not just the annual average.

Air quality in Samba is worst in July — around 47 µg/m³ PM2.5 (poor), about 2.1× the cleanest month (January, 23 µg/m³).

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).

Location & terrain

Where is Samba?

Samba sits at 8.9°S, 13.2°E, 3 m above sea level, in Angola. The nearest listed city is Nova Vida, 4.0 km away.

Topography around Samba

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Samba.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Samba has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 77 m around an average of 35 m above sea level; within 16 km,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 133 m; within 80 km,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 396 m.

The land around Samba is covered by artificial surfaces (59%) and water (30%) within 3 km, water (43%) and artificial surfaces (39%) within 16 km, and water (41%) and grassland (30%) within 80 km.
